Does Skiljan pay any attention to suggestions? IrfanView could be
soooo much better, but he seems headstrong to avoid anyone else's
ideas. I like many of his features in IrfanView, but others like
XNView, FireGraphic, even Uniview are more convenient.

I would like to see IrfanView display pictures in CENTER SCREEN,
on black background, with the window fully opened. All the others
mentioned do this. All IrfanView can do is to vary the size of
the window, which is distracting in the extreme, especially with
other programming in the background. So unattractive!

Options > Properties > Misc. 2 > "Center window when loading new image"

View > Display options >
"Fit images to desktop" or better "Fit only big images to desktop"

If you want black background then use fullscreen option.
